Rover 25 MOT pass rate & common failures
28,262 MOT tests on the Rover 25 (1998–2007) give it a 75.0% pass rate. Against superminis of a similar age (29.3% fail rate), the 25 comes out 4.3pp better. Its most common failure areas are lighting & signalling, body, structure & corrosion and brakes.
What the MOT record shows
No single area dominates — lighting & signalling (13.3%) and body, structure & corrosion (11.6%) are close, so failures are spread across several systems rather than one weak point.
At component level the recurring items are joints, component mounting prescribed areas and wipers — joints alone was recorded 2,409 times.
Condition tracks the odometer closely. Failures run at 17.0% in the 0-30k band and 29.1% in the 150k+ band, a 12.1-point spread.
Fuel type barely separates them — petrol fails 24.9% of the time against 25.9% for diesel.
Advisories point at the next bill rather than this one: tyres was flagged on 25.4% of tests without failing them.

Most common failures (all years)
| # | Category | % of tests affected | Tests |
|---|---|---|---|
| 1 | Lighting & signalling | 13.3% | 3,757 |
| 2 | Body, structure & corrosion | 11.6% | 3,283 |
| 3 | Brakes | 7.6% | 2,147 |
| 4 | Suspension | 5.7% | 1,614 |
| 5 | Visibility | 5.3% | 1,492 |
| 6 | Emissions & environmental | 4.4% | 1,247 |
| 7 | Tyres | 4.3% | 1,216 |
| 8 | Seat belts & restraints | 2.7% | 775 |

Failure rate by mileage
Higher-mileage cars tend to fail more — often the most useful guide to real condition.
| Mileage band | Tests | Fail rate |
|---|---|---|
| 0-30k | 2,389 | 17.0% |
| 30-60k | 10,769 | 23.4% |
| 60-90k | 9,115 | 26.3% |
| 90-120k | 4,118 | 28.5% |
| 120-150k | 1,263 | 30.0% |
| 150k+ | 598 | 29.1% |

What to check before buying a Rover 25
- Lighting & signalling (13.3% of tests): Often a cheap bulb, but persistent issues can mean wiring or corrosion in the units. Typical repair: £10–£150.
- Body, structure & corrosion (11.6% of tests): The one to take seriously on older cars — corrosion to structural areas can be costly and is an MOT failure. Typical repair: £200–£1,500+.
- Brakes (7.6% of tests): Pads/discs are routine wear; binding, imbalance or corroded pipes are more serious — test for pulling under braking. Typical repair: £100–£350 per axle.
Repair costs are rough UK ballpark ranges to set expectations, not quotes — actual prices vary widely by car, parts and garage.
